WebThe speed of a sound wave refers to how fast a sound wave is passed from particle to particle through a medium. The speed of a sound wave in air depends upon the properties of the air - primarily the temperature. Sound travels faster in solids than it does in liquids; sound travels slowest in gases such as air. The speed of sound can be calculated as … Web24 jul. 2024 · At 20 °C (68 °F), the speed of sound in air is about 343 meters per second (1125 ft/s; 1235 km/h; 767 mph; 667 knots), or one kilometer in 2.9 s, or one mile in 4.7 s.
